Output 250566de4bcd5b8609a1a28d8745150551130678fa27474ca39ac3ce5ffbff3d:6

value
13022618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3cb3fdfe6d0b13f9908b14718f42d9843438845 OP_EQUAL
address
MTD2HvtcVDNvYevbR9TS5JHdAYu7HRMWLW
transaction
250566de4bcd5b8609a1a28d8745150551130678fa27474ca39ac3ce5ffbff3d
spent
true